Application Process
- Review building permit requirements and project-specific submittal documents on the Building Permits page.
- Create an account in Draper's Online Services Portal.
- Submit the permit application and upload plans/documents through the portal.
- Include required outside-agency and city approvals at time of application where applicable.
- Pay fees and deposits, including application fees for certain permit types such as demolition.
- After issuance, schedule inspections through the portal by selecting the inspection card and ready inspection action.
Typical processing time: Not clearly posted as a fixed citywide review time.

General Requirements
The Building Division conducts permit review and inspections for new construction and remodeling requiring compliance with local and state-mandated regulations.
Required Documents
- Permit application
- Plans
- Outside-agency approvals
- Project-specific checklists
- For demolition: utility disconnect letters, environmental clearances, and photo documentation

Fees
- Plan check fee
- Applies through permit review; demolition submittal requirements note a $150 application fee invoiced 24-48 hours after submission.
- Permit fee formula
- City consolidated fee schedule covers building review and permit categories.
- Payment note
- Portal-based invoicing and payment workflow; applicants receive invoice notices by email.

Inspections
How to Schedule
- Online Services Portal (online)
- 801-576-6581 for portal issues (phone)
- Inspection hours
- Monday-Friday 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.; same-day inspections not available.
Typical inspection sequence: Log in, open Inspections, view ready inspections, and request specific inspection/reinspection; results visible in portal after completion.
